I dont get xtra money for waiting--that is the labels...my track for instance--Now that Its good to go...they are sending the acapella to a certain big name producer to do a rmx for the bside...that will take maybe ?? 2 months? i hope? idk--however long...after that tho we're gonna push it as fast as it goes...as far as THE END...look at it this way--its the same deal as a movie sequel to a blockbuster--Chapter was maybe one of the most successful domestic hard progressive tracks (remember sandstorm, derb and all those were originally imprts until denny grabbed em on groovy) and there is a LOT of money in a sequel..esp since its just a sick as the original.....so mike took his time in shopping it and deciding---now that he has chosen a label...they have to go thru all the legal mumbo-jumbo---labels are not out to help producers...'everyone wants something for nuthing" is what i was told by someone and its totally true....there is a difference tho between tracks like Luz and pressure that havent even been presented to labels yet and tracks like the end or my track which are with labels now--- as far as leaking--I honestly dont know what the future holds and as my true profession, I am in law school studying to figure out the legal ramifications of free music and stuff like that---true...i agree when it hits stores I person will rip the vinyl and send it out to everyone on the net--I guess as a producer you hope this doesnt happen but the reality is that it does and it will...so why not have me send it months in advance? 1-anticipation is what makes some of these tracks better (or worse--diamonds...ehhh) 2-why does everyone go see draper or JP or mac spin? one reason is that you know you will hear their tracks that arent on your computer or in stores yet--there are other reasons to see them I agree but when i go out to hear a DJ spin...usually its to hear what they;ve been working on and what may be available in the future...I used my track initally as aspringboard to get people to come see a no-name upstate westchester kid spin in NYC...i never thought of signing my track until i follow the advice of many people in the biz... also--we are priviidged if u think about it...we know about tracks the second they are finshed....we're always trying to get the one-up on everyone to say, I've got this unreleased track--i know not everyone is like this but this DJ CLue exclusive hip hop mentality is why I STOPPED spinning that junk and came over to what I spin now....those people have no clue about whats going on-- again---i dont say this to offend anyone--just giving ya'll a perspective from inside the game (maybe abotu 2 inches inside the door since I just got in --lol) my 2 cents Mike BuGouT

Mike can't give out the end for the same reason that I can't give out my track--- with music like ours, we appeal only to a rather small audience compared to other genres--so every sale and every record counts---Labels have rejected tracks that people send out--The first thing i was told about my track by the label was DO NOT GIVE IT TO ANYONE and when they are signing your checks--you listen to them tony hasnt brought pressure to a label and JP hasnt brought Luz to a label either---I know JP wants to perect luz's tracks--but when he does....its HIS label they are coming out on (from what i understand==Deeper) I dont mean to sound like a dick b/c i'm all for free music and all--but some/most of these guys eat off of this....so when a song leaks and is all over the internet and most DJ's and listeners decide to DL instead of buy--they lose money.....true...it is all about the music and the love and yaddayaddayadda....but does the love pay the bills?
